
Hardback
Published 10 Oct 2023
Save $23.46
- RRP $117.76
- $94.30
3 results
$23.46off
Hardback
Published 10 Oct 2023
Save $23.46
Paperback
Published 15 Dec 2020
Hardback
Published 16 Dec 2014